Grabs one-year deal
Cotter agreed to terms on a one-year, $2.15 million contract with Vancouver on Wednesday.
ANALYSIS
Cotter missed the 20-point mark last year for the first time since his 2022-23 rookie campaign, which may have factored into New Jersey's decision not to give him a qualifying offer. Even with a change of scenery, the 26-year-old center is unlikely to be anything more than a bottom-six forward who helps kill penalties. He'll add some value in formats that utilize hits, but is otherwise a relative non-factor.

In his three seasons as a full-time NHL player, Cotter has two double-digit goal-scoring campaigns. In both of those seasons, his shooting percentage was over 17 percent, a high mark to try to maintain year-over-year. Those two seasons, including last year’s numbers of 16 goals and six assists, bookend a season in which the 25-year-old scored just seven times, shooting 7.0 percent, though he had a career-high 25 points that year. Whether or not the goal-scoring is present or not, one thing remains constant and that's Cotter's ability to bring the boom. The physical forward threw a career-high 245 hits last season, the second-straight 200-hit season of his career. At the very least, it’s fair to expect another big physical season from Cotter, but to expect him to score enough goals to warrant fantasy consideration might not be as wise of a gamble.

Off to Worlds
Cotter was announced as a member of Team USA's IIHF World Championship roster Thursday.
ANALYSIS
Cotter will try to end his year on a positive note. He had just 15 points in 79 regular-season games for the Devils, the worst full-season performance in his career.
